#302fce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#302fce is composed of 18.8% red, 18.4% green and 80.8%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 76.7% cyan, 77.2% magenta, 0% yellow and 19.2% black. It has a hue angle of 240.4 degrees, a saturation of 62.8% and a lightness of 49.6%. #302fce color hex could be obtained by blending #605eff with #00009d. Closest websafe color is: #3333cc.

#302fce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#302fce has RGB values of R:48, G:47, B:206 and CMYK values of C:0.77, M:0.77, Y:0, K:0.19. Its decimal value is 3157966.
